Changes within living memory: what changed during Elizabeth II's lifetime?
This unit helps students understand a time span covering four generations before their birth. It teaches about Queen Elizabeth II's reign, offering a simple overview of c.80 years of British history. Students also learn how a major public figure holds authority and performs national duties.
You will learn to talk about how Britain changed during Queen Elizabeth II's life and why people remember her reign.
Queen Elizabeth II died in 2022 after a long life. Many people watched or attended her state funeral.
